Brightway Living & Learning is a premier non-profit provider of human services on Long Island, including educational, residential, day habilitation, and vocational programs. Building on a 65-year legacy as the Developmental Disabilities Institute (DDI), Brightway supports over 1,600 children and adults with autism and other developmental disabilities through a full continuum of care. By employing persistence, adaptability, and the power of behavioral science, Brightway’s dedicated professionals enable individuals to grow, learn, and meet milestones at their own pace. As an Early Childhood Aide Instructor, also known as Teacher Assistant, you will work closely alongside Special Education Teachers as part of the interdisciplinary team, providing support to children with developmental disabilities on a variety of age-appropriate educational goals. You are offered on-going trainings and support provided by experts in the field of education. Our classrooms are enriched with “State of the Art" materials to meet the needs of our students with outdoor learning areas. School programs are 12-month calendar with 9 weeks of vacation. We offer the opportunity to work in a self-contained setting utilizing the principles of Applied Behavior Analysis (ABA) with Autism Spectrum Disorder.

Candidates must possess a High School Diploma and a minimum of 6 college credits, along with fluency in a second language in addition to thorough knowledge of English. Applicants are required to obtain NYS Level I Teaching Assistant certification within the first six months of employment.
